Noble Plains appoints Zimmerman as CEO, director

NOBL · Price
Executive Summary
- Noble Plains Uranium Corp. has appointed Drew Zimmerman as Chief Executive Officer and Director, effective November 2, 2025.
- Long-serving CEO Paul Cowley is transitioning to the role of Chief Operating Officer and remains on the Board of Directors, continuing to lead technical programs and project advancement.
- Bradley Parkes has stepped down from the Board of Directors but retains his position as Vice-President of Exploration.
Key Details
- CEO Appointment: Drew Zimmerman appointed as CEO and Director, effective Nov. 2, 2025.
- COO Transition: Paul Cowley transitions from CEO to Chief Operating Officer; remains on the Board of Directors.
- Board Changes: Bradley Parkes steps down from the Board of Directors; remains VP of Exploration.
- CEO Background: Zimmerman has over 5 years of public company executive experience and 14+ years in capital markets and commodity sectors. He is a CFA charter holder with a B.Com in International Business from the University of Victoria.
- CEO Tenure Context: Zimmerman joined Noble Plains as President in May 2025, guiding recent acquisitions, financings, and project development initiatives.
- Strategic Focus: The company is advancing its U.S. in-situ recovery (ISR) uranium portfolio, specifically the flagship Duck Creek project (awaiting final drill permit) and the Shirley Central project.
- Market Positioning: Noble Plains aims to build compliant NI 43-101 resources in Wyoming ISR districts, leveraging strengthening uranium prices and U.S. policy prioritizing domestic supply.
